The licensing and building codes required for kitchen improvements

Comprehending permitting and building codes is essential for any kitchen remodeling project in Maryland, ensuring your kitchen upgrades meet local safety and structural standards. Professionals stress the need of getting proper permits before beginning significant kitchen remodeling work, especially when altering the footprint, plumbing (including a new sink or gas lines for a cooktop), or electrical systems. Failing to conform to these regulations can cause to costly fines, project delays, or even the demand to undo previously accomplished kitchen remodeling efforts, impacting the home remodeling timeline.

These codes control aspects like electrical wiring, gas line installation, ventilation, and structural modifications, all essential for a safe and functional kitchen. A comprehensive kitchen makeover often includes changes that require inspections to verify compliance. For instance, moving load-bearing walls during a large-scale kitchen remodeling demands specific structural engineering plans and inspections. Even a seemingly minor remodel kitchen project like relocating a sink can instigate plumbing code requirements. Always confer with local authorities or skilled practitioners before renovating kitchen spaces to explain specific conditions for your kitchen remodeling project, guaranteeing a seamless and compliant process.

Selecting backsplash options and installation procedures

Backsplashes present both aesthetic appeal and vital protection against splashes, playing a significant role in any Kitchen Remodeling project. Common choices range from classic ceramic or porcelain tiles to more modern options like glass, metal, or natural stone, each demanding specific installation techniques. For effective Kitchen Remodeling, appropriate surface preparation is critical; this often involves ensuring the wall is clean, dry, and flat, sometimes necessitating minor drywall repairs before any adhesive is applied over the existing flooring.

The chosen material dictates the adhesive and grouting methods, directly impacting the longevity and finish of your Kitchen Remodeling. Professionals carefully apply thin-set mortar for most tile backsplashes, ensuring even coverage and strong adhesion. Specific considerations emerge when installing a backsplash over existing flooring or if the subfloor has any movement; flexible adhesives might be necessary to prevent cracking. Meticulous measuring and cutting are essential for a seamless look, making this a critical step in comprehensive Kitchen Remodeling.
